Down with King Joffrey! Campaign by DDB in Auckland uses tweets to pull down statue of Joffrey
Keeping it spoiler free for those who haven’t seen the first three episodes of Game of Thrones season four yet, but Joffrey is a nasty piece of work.
Making his ex-fiancee look at people's heads on spikes, shooting women with arrows and ordering family pets killed: he's not likely to win a Nobel Peace Prize.
As the series began, DDB in Auckland created a campaign which saw those who opposed the King (a result of incest and therefore not technically King anyway…) able to tweet using hashtag #BringDownTheKing in order to smash a statue of Joffrey.
The statue of the great man stood in a town square in New Zealand before its demise.
